Acoustical engineering is a branch of engineering that monitors sounds and vibrations in order to find methods to reduce and minimize harmful and annoying sounds. This type of engineering is important to both the public and private sector. The acoustics of a workplace can make or break a business. Clients and customers do not want to frequent restaurants and offices where the noise level is unpleasantly loud. Too much noise in the workplace can decrease productivity of employees. Business owners may find themselves liable to lawsuits or subject to state-induced sanctions if they expose their employees to harmful noise levels.Acoustical engineers find and fix problems of too much noise, as well as work with ultrasound and sonar in a variety of applications. Acoustical engineers can find plenty of employment in a variety of disciplines, including architectural acoustical engineering, audio engineering and electronic acoustical engineering, all of which can be rewarding and high-paying careers. Earn an acoustical engineer degree
From certificate programs to post-doctoral degrees, there are many different levels of acoustical engineering programs. From online degrees to traditional colleges and universities, there is an unlimited supply of acoustical engineering education and training opportunities.
Try: The Acoustical Society of America provides good tutorials on how to map your education goals and career paths in acoustical engineering. You might also consider courses from The Stanford University Center for Computer Research in Music and Acoustics. The Carnegie Mellon University Department of Mechanical Engineering offers the Acoustics, Vibrations and Noise Control Laboratory where you can conduct your research.
